Establishment card renewal in Dubai

Your establishment card keeps the company's immigration file active. This guide explains where to renew it, which documents normally matter, why GDRFA and ICP charges differ, and what to check before the card expires.

Short answer: renew through the immigration authority responsible for your company file—usually GDRFA Dubai or ICP—after confirming the trade licence is valid. Upload the requested company and signatory documents, pay the authority's displayed fees and save the renewed electronic card. Start before expiry so visa work does not get held up.

An establishment card is not the same thing as a trade licence. The trade licence authorises the company to conduct its business activity. The establishment card connects that company to the immigration system, allowing it to use services connected with investor, partner and employee sponsorship. First identify the authority handling the file

Do not begin with a random renewal form. Begin with the authority named on the existing immigration file. A Dubai company may use GDRFA Dubai, while companies under federal immigration channels use ICP. A free-zone company may start through its zone portal even when the final immigration service sits with one of those authorities.

This distinction matters because the document list, portal journey and fee components are not identical. The official GDRFA establishment-card renewal service and the ICP renewal service should be treated as the current sources for the file they govern.

Documents commonly requested

  • Valid trade licence. If the licence has expired, renew it before attempting the immigration renewal.
  • Existing establishment-card or immigration-file details. Keep the card number and company file reference available.
  • Partners appendix. This may be requested where the shareholders are not fully shown on the trade licence.
  • Authorised signatories' passports and Emirates IDs. The exact identity documents depend on who is authorised on the file.
  • Manager authorisation. A notarised authorisation may be required where a manager is acting for the owners.
  • Additional activity documents. Regulated businesses and particular legal forms can be asked for supporting approvals.

Upload clear, current copies. A blurred passport, an old partners appendix or a mismatch between the licence and immigration record can turn a routine renewal into a correction exercise.

Renewal process, step by step

StepWhat to doWhat to check
1. Check expiry datesReview the trade licence, establishment card and relevant portal subscriptionDo not assume they all expire together
2. Confirm the authorityUse GDRFA, ICP or the free-zone channel linked to the companyMatch the existing immigration file
3. Update company recordsResolve changes to owners, manager, trade name or address firstThe application must match current records
4. Submit documentsUpload the valid licence and requested company/signatory documentsUse legible, complete copies
5. Pay displayed feesPay through the official portal or authorised channelKeep the receipt and fee breakdown
6. Save the renewed cardDownload the electronic card and update the company compliance fileConfirm the new validity date

What does establishment card renewal cost?

There is no honest universal number. GDRFA and ICP publish different components, and a free zone may charge for its own portal or handling in addition to the government transaction. The amount can also change with validity period, urgent processing or amendments made alongside the renewal.

What happens when the card expires?

The company does not disappear, but its immigration work can stop. New visa applications, sponsorship actions and certain amendments may be unavailable until the file is active again. Depending on the authority and jurisdiction, late fees may apply. An expired trade licence can create a second blockage, which is why renewal planning should cover the licence and immigration file together.

Common reasons a renewal is delayed

  • The trade licence is expired or the renewed licence has not updated in the immigration system.
  • The shareholder, manager, address or trade name differs between company and immigration records.
  • An authorised signatory's passport or Emirates ID has expired.
  • The application was started in the wrong authority or free-zone channel.
  • A portal subscription, company amendment or outstanding immigration issue also needs attention.

Renewal is also a useful compliance check

Before pressing submit, verify who is authorised to sign, which visas remain active, whether any former employee still appears on the file and whether the licence activity and company details are current. Establishment card renewal — common questions

How do I renew an establishment card in Dubai?
Renew through the immigration channel responsible for the company, usually GDRFA Dubai or ICP. Confirm the trade licence is valid, upload the requested company and signatory documents, pay the displayed fees and retain the renewed electronic card.
What documents are needed for establishment card renewal?
Common requirements include a valid trade licence, authorised signatories' passport copies, the partners appendix where applicable and manager authorisation where required. The authority may request more for a regulated activity or particular legal form.
How much is establishment card renewal in Dubai?
There is no single fee for every company. GDRFA, ICP and free zones use different fee components. Check the live amount shown for the authority handling your company file and ask for government and service charges to be separated.
Can I renew with an expired trade licence?
Usually the trade licence must be valid because it is a core renewal document. Renew the licence first, then update the immigration file and establishment card.
What happens if the establishment card expires?
Company immigration services can be interrupted, including new visa applications and some renewals or amendments. Late charges may apply depending on the authority and jurisdiction.
Is it the same as the trade licence?
No. The trade licence authorises the business activity. The establishment card registers the company with immigration so it can use company immigration and sponsorship services.
